In January of 2007 Anthony Williams and Don Tapscott published “Wikinomics: How Mass Collaboration Changes Everything”. This book is full of examples of companies and people collaborating. The premise is we can't know everything and be everywhere. The best companies help get their message out based on their ability to work collectively and collaboratively. So why not join in, or if you already are collaborative, step it up. You will find many others who are also experts, who can get you the information you need.

There are lots of vehicles available. Everything from your own circle of business friends to your associations, to your blog (this could go into establishing yourself as the expert section). Most of us have industry publications we can share valuable information in – and meet colleagues to collaborate with.

Collaboration is so powerful because it quickly develops trust. When we trust we instinctively move more business along faster because we can depend on our collaborator. How do you know when to trust? This is a challenge. Many of my successful colleagues say they simply look at all the evidence and then trust until proven otherwise.

Interactive groups, also called Mastermind Groups, can be so powerful. We talk about it but how do we make the time for it. You make the time. It takes surprisingly little time. Most of the time is spent finding the right group or colleague to collaborate with. (Get into how these things can be utilized effectively as lead generators, etc.)

These groups provide you with great ideas. The ideas bring you to new contacts and often new customers as well as business partners.

Napoleon Hill wrote that being active in a Master Mind group is the number one characteristic common to self-made millionaires.

The very good news is that there is great value in working with companies or individuals of different backgrounds. This makes for more varied and creative solutions.

Mastermind Groups can be very informal – from a group of key people that form your inner circle with whom you manage and leverage business opportunities to a defined group with regular meetings and goals.

Whatever route you choose collaboration simply leverages your business contacts and builds business faster.
